Wigan Wallgate Station stands out not just for its conveniency but also for its comprehensive facilities that make every journey a bit smoother. The ticket office accommodates travelers every day of the week, opening early at 6:00 AM from Monday to Saturday. For those preferring a self-service option, ticket machines are accessible and come with the capability to collect online purchases. Unlike many stations, Wigan Wallgate places a premium on accessibility, boasting step-free access across the board, along with induction loops and accessible ticket machines.
The station doesn’t offer lounges, but there’s ample seating space for waiting passengers. Furthermore, security is a priority there, with extensive CCTV coverage and specified cycling storage areas including lockers and stands—a boon for any cyclist. Unfortunately, an absence of catering services, ATMs, and baby-changing facilities might see you better served heading out into the nearby town center for some essentials.
Once at Wigan Wallgate, you are not limited to just rail travel. Convenient transport connections abound, allowing for onward travel throughout the area. The rail replacement service is efficiently picked up from the Wallgate service bus stop. There is also a strategically located bus line adjacent to Wigan North Western rail station, providing connections to St Helens, Southport, Ormskirk, and Warrington. For those moments when taxis are the best option, nearby services can easily be booked through the Northern Railway Cab4You service.

Hornbeam Park Station is all about convenience. While it doesn't boast a ticket office, fear not—ticket machines are available to ensure you can purchase your fare hassle-free. These machines are accessible and equipped with induction loops, though they're cashless, so make sure to have your card ready. For the tech-savvy traveler, smartcards are issued and validated here too, facilitating smooth commutes.
While staff assistance isn't available on-site, helpful resources like customer information screens and announcements ensure you won't miss your train. In case you need help, helplines are just a call away. Relax about your luggage because there's no dedicated storage, but remember that CCTV is in operation for peace of mind.
The station has limited seating and amenities, so it's best for those who prefer to arrive just in time. While there's ample cycle storage with CCTV coverage, accessible parking and car park equipment are limited, making alternative travel arrangements more favorable.
At Hornbeam Park, you'll find that connectivity is just a few steps away. It's easy to hop onto the regular bus services, with nearby stops ensuring a swift transition from train to road. Check out the busline 0871 200 2233 for schedule information. If you're planning on catching a taxi, the cab booking service from Northern Railway makes it simple. Rail replacement services are conveniently located on Hookstone Road, offering added flexibility should the need arise.
